[發明專利]將單微處理器核劃分為多個小核的可配置微處理器和方法無效
| 申請號: | 200810083502.X | 申請日: | 2008-03-06 |
| 公開(公告)號: | CN101266559A | 公開(公告)日: | 2008-09-17 |
| 發明(設計)人: | 唐·Q·古延;杭·Q·利;巴拉臘姆·辛哈羅伊 | 申請(專利權)人: | 國際商業機器公司 |
| 主分類號: | G06F9/50 | 分類號: | G06F9/50;G06F15/78 |
| 代理公司: | 北京市柳沈律師事務所 | 代理人: | 黃小臨 |
| 地址: | 美國紐*** | 國省代碼: | 美國;US |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 微處理器 分為 多個小核 配置 方法 | ||
1.一種用于將單微處理器核劃分為多個小核的計算機實現的方法,所述計算機實現的方法包括:
對單微處理器核的資源進行劃分,以形成分區資源,其中每個分區資源包括所述單微處理器核中的未分區資源的一部分;以及
通過將一組分區資源分配給所述多個小核中的每個小核而從所述單微處理器核形成所述多個小核,其中每組分區資源專用于一個小核以使得每個小核獨立于所述多個小核中的其他小核而運作,并且其中每個小核使用其專用的一組分區資源來處理指令。
2.如權利要求1所述的計算機實現的方法,其中當微處理器軟件設置用來對所述單微處理器核進行劃分的分區位時,進行所述分區步驟。
3.如權利要求1所述的計算機實現的方法,其中所述單微處理器核的資源包括結構性資源和非結構性資源。
4.如權利要求3所述的計算機實現的方法,其中,所述結構性資源包括數據高速緩存、指令高速緩存和指令緩沖器。
5.如權利要求3所述的計算機實現的方法,其中所述非結構性資源包括重命名資源、指令隊列、加載/存儲隊列、鏈接/計數堆棧和完成表。
6.如權利要求1所述的計算機實現的方法,還包括:
響應于所述多個小核中的一個小核接收到專用于該小核的指令高速緩存分區中的指令、將所述指令提供給專用于所述小核的指令緩沖器分區;
將來自所述指令緩沖器分區的指令分派給專用于所述小核的執行單元;
執行所述指令;以及
完成所述指令。
7.如權利要求6所述的計算機實現的方法,其中所述執行單元包括專用于所述小核的加載/存儲單元分區、定點單元分區、浮點單元分區和分支單元分區。
8.如權利要求7所述的計算機實現的方法,其中所述小核中的分支單元分區執行分支指令,并取得獨立于其他小核的指令流。
9.如權利要求7所述的計算機實現的方法,其中所述加載/存儲單元分區訪問數據高速緩存分區以獲得獨立于其他小核的加載/存儲數據。
10.如權利要求1所述的計算機實現的方法,其中將所述單微處理器核劃分為多個小核以處理低計算強度工作量。
11.如權利要求1所述的計算機實現的方法,其中在所述單微處理器核中的未分區資源的一部分是所述未分區資源的一半。
12.一種可配置微處理器,包括:
多個小核,以及
在所述多個小核的每個小核中的一組分區資源,其中該組分區資源包括從單微處理器核分區的資源,并且其中每個分區資源包括所述單微處理器核中的未分區資源的一部分;
其中,通過將一組分區資源分配給所述多個小核中的每個小核來形成所述多個小核,
其中每組分區資源專用于一個小核以使得每個小核獨立于所述多個小核中的其他小核而運作,以及
其中每個小核使用其專用的一組分區資源來處理指令。
13.如權利要求12所述的可配置微處理器,其中,響應于微處理器軟件設置了分區位,從所述單微處理器核分區所述資源。
14.如權利要求12所述的可配置微處理器,其中從所述單微處理器核分區的資源包括結構性資源和非結構性資源。
15.如權利要求14所述的可配置微處理器,其中所述結構性資源包括數據高速緩存、指令高速緩存和指令緩沖器。
16.如權利要求14所述的可配置微處理器,其中所述非結構性資源包括重命名資源、指令隊列、加載/存儲隊列、鏈接/計數堆棧和完成表。
17.如權利要求12所述的可配置微處理器,其中小核通過接收專用于該小核的指令高速緩存分區中的指令、將所述指令提供給專用于所述小核的指令緩沖器、將來自所述指令緩沖器分區的指令分派給專用于該小核的執行單元、執行所述指令并完成所述指令來處理指令。
18.如權利要求12所述的可配置微處理器,其中將所述單微處理器核劃分為多個小核以處理低計算強度工作量。
19.如權利要求12所述的可配置微處理器,其中所述單微處理器核中的未分區資源的一部分是所述未分區資源的一半。
20.一種信息處理系統,包括:
至少一個處理單元,該處理單元包括多個小核,其中所述多個小核中的每個小核包括在每個小核中的一組分區資源,其中該組分區資源包括從單微處理器核劃分的資源,其中每組分區資源專用于一個小核以使得每個小核獨立于所述多個小核中的其他小核而運作,并且其中每個小核使用其專用的一組分區資源來處理指令。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于國際商業機器公司,未經國際商業機器公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/200810083502.X/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:聚結過濾介質及方法
- 下一篇:具噪聲消除功能的可編程增益放大器





